Key Takeaways

  • Demand a Real Diagnosis: If your doctor writes a prescription for physical therapy with a generic diagnosis of “hip pain,” walk out. You deserve a provider who acts like a detective to find the true source of the problem.
  • Bursitis is a Symptom, Not the Cause: Bursae don’t just magically inflame on their own; something structural is rubbing against them. You must treat the underlying structural issue to stop the inflammation.
  • Treat the Function, Not the Image: A labral tear on an MRI does not mean you automatically need a massive hip scope surgery, especially if your symptoms point to an entirely different issue.
  • Check Your Foundation: If you have chronic hip pain, do not ignore the surrounding structures! The SI joint, lower back, pelvic floor, and even walking unevenly in a walking boot must be evaluated to ensure you aren’t treating the wrong area.
